Here are a few more insights into D-Wave and the broader quantum computing sector:
1. **Technology Overview**: D-Wave specializes in quantum annealing technology, which is particularly suited for optimization problems. This contrasts with other quantum computing approaches, like gate-based quantum computing. Understanding these differences can help when evaluating D-Wave's position in the market.
2. **Use Cases**: D-Wave's technology has been applied in various fields, including finance (for portfolio optimization), logistics (for route optimization), and artificial intelligence (to enhance machine learning algorithms). These practical applications can be appealing to potential investors.
3. **Competitors**: In the quantum computing space, companies like IBM, Google, and Rigetti are also significant players. Each company has its unique strategy and technology focus, making it essential to understand D-Wave's competitive advantages and market positioning.
4. **Investment Landscape**: The quantum computing sector has seen increasing investment from both private and public sectors. As governments and large corporations recognize the potential of quantum technology, this trend could lead to more funding opportunities for companies like D-Wave.
5. **Future Outlook**: Industry experts generally predict significant advancements in quantum computing over the next decade. As the technology matures, we can expect an increase in commercial applications and broader acceptance in various industries.
